(mod number divisor) | Function: Return second result of FLOOR.
|
Example:(defun bref (buf n) (svref (buf-vec buf) (mod n (length (buf-vec buf))))) | Mentioned in: CLtL2 - 12.6. Type Conversions and Component Extractions on Numbers CLtL2 - 17.3.
